I also have several of this little thing…
It’s called Arctic Bells… and yes, it is a daffodil, though a unique one. It’s very tiny. It only stands about three or four inches high. As you can see, the Coronet is very straight, almost looking like a hoop skirt. And it’s rear petals are thin and spider-like. It’s a delicate little bloomer, and one I’m so glad I added to my garden.
